Mutable default argument bug

The mutable default argument items=[] causes the same list to be shared across calls, leading to unexpected accumulation. It looks like this might result in ['apple', 'banana'] for the second print instead of just ['banana'].

Code suggestion
Check the AI-generated fix before applying
Suggested change
def add_item(item, items=[]):
items.append(item)
return items
def add_item(item, items=None):
if items is None:
items = []
items.append(item)
return items

Incorrect type comparison

The equality check compares a string (from input) with an integer (a*b), which will always be False. Converting answer to int would allow correct validation of user responses.

Code suggestion
Check the AI-generated fix before applying
Suggested change
if answer == a*b:
if int(answer) == a*b:
